Gerald Grosvenor: Wealth, Legacy, and the Grosvenor Estate Empire

Gerald Grosvenor was the 6th Duke of Westminster, a figure whose landholdings and business decisions shaped commercial property markets across the United Kingdom. His career combined inherited estate management with modern corporate governance, influencing urban development in major cities.

As a high-net-worth individual, Grosvenor oversaw one of Europe's largest private real estate portfolios, balancing long-term asset preservation with bold investments. Understanding his role helps explain how private ownership intersects with public space in dense urban environments.

Full Name Gerald Grosvenor
Title 6th Duke of Westminster
Dates 22 December 1951 – 9 August 2016
Core Business Property investment and development
Key Markets United Kingdom, international urban centers
